What are lab-grown gemstones?
Lab-cultured gemstones, as the name suggests, are synthetic gems created through technological processes that simulate natural conditions within a controlled laboratory environment. By precisely replicating the high-temperature and high-pressure conditions required for crystal formation in nature, researchers are able to cultivate synthetic crystals of exceptional quality.
A key technique employed in their cultivation is the Czochralski method (pulling method), which has been widely used since its introduction in 1917. The core of this process involves immersing a high-quality seed crystal into molten material and then slowly pulling it upward to grow a complete single crystal. This technique is commonly used to synthesize important gem materials such as sapphire, ruby, and various types of garnet. By the 1960s, breakthroughs in crystal shaping technology enabled shape-controlled crystal growth.
This means that crystals can be directly pulled into specific shapes during the growth process, significantly reducing the material waste and processing costs associated with subsequent cutting and polishing, thereby improving raw material utilization and production efficiency.
The core advantage of lab cultivation lies in real-time monitoring and precise control over the growth process. This high level of control ensures excellent gem quality and consistency between batches. More importantly, it compresses the gem formation timeline from the millions of years required in nature to just a few weeks or months.
As a result, lab-grown gemstones available on the market today are not only more affordable but also typically exhibit superior color and clarity. They break through the geographical limitations and price barriers associated with rare mineral resources, allowing more people to appreciate and own the beauty of radiant gemstones. These gems have become an indispensable element in contemporary jewelry design, continuously driving innovation and sustainable development within the industry.
